What Is Hardscaping? (And Why San Leandro Homes Need It)
Hardscaping refers to the non-living, structural elements of your landscape—the permanent features that create the foundation and framework of your outdoor spaces. Unlike softscaping elements such as plants, flowers, and grass, hardscape features include patios, walkways, retaining walls, outdoor kitchens, fire pits, and other man-made structures that define how you use and enjoy your property.
The art of successful hardscaping lies in seamlessly blending these structural elements with your home’s architecture and the natural beauty of your landscape. When executed properly, hardscaping doesn’t just add visual appeal—it solves practical problems, manages water drainage, prevents erosion, and creates inviting spaces for outdoor living and entertainment.

Hardscape Materials We Work With
Interlocking Concrete Pavers
Available in countless colors, shapes, and patterns, concrete pavers offer versatility, strength, and value. These manufactured units provide consistent sizing and quality control while delivering authentic texture and depth.
Natural Stone
Bring timeless elegance to your hardscape with natural stone options including flagstone, bluestone, limestone, slate, and granite. Each stone offers unique characteristics, colors, and textures that create one-of-a-kind installations.
Brick
Classic brick pavers provide traditional charm and proven durability. Ideal for walkways, patios, and driveways, brick hardscaping offers a warm, inviting aesthetic that complements various architectural styles.
Decorative Concrete
Modern decorative concrete options provide the look of natural stone or pavers at a lower cost. Stamped, stained, or textured concrete can create beautiful hardscape surfaces when properly installed.
Retaining Wall Systems
We work with leading retaining wall manufacturers to provide engineered systems that combine structural integrity with aesthetic appeal. Options range from natural stone aesthetics to contemporary clean lines.
Maintenance & Longevity
Here’s the thing about interlocking pavers: they’re built to last. With San Leandro’s mix of hot summers and wet winters, we see a lot of materials crack or shift. But not these. With proper installation—the kind we do—your paver driveway or patio can hold up for 30 to 50 years. That’s a long time to enjoy your space without stress. What does maintenance look like? A sweep now and then, maybe a power wash after the rainy season, and topping off the joint sand every few years. That’s it. And if a tree root or a utility crew ever messes with a section, no sweat. We just lift the affected pavers, fix the base, and set ’em back. No one will ever know it happened. We hear this a lot from folks in San Leandro: “Why didn’t we do this sooner?”

Frequently Asked Questions About San Leandro
Why do San Leandro driveways crack more often than in some nearby cities?
San Leandro sits atop clay-heavy soils that expand when wet and contract during dry spells. This seasonal shifting, combined with the city's freeze-thaw cycles (even if rare, they do occur), puts extra stress on asphalt. A proper base with adequate compaction and drainage is critical here—something a local paving contractor knows how to handle.
Do I need a permit to repave my driveway in San Leandro?
Yes, the City of San Leandro requires a building permit for any paving work that changes the grade or drainage of your property, including full driveway replacements. Permits are obtained through the City's Building and Safety Division, and your contractor should pull the permit and schedule the required inspections.
How does the nearby San Leandro Marina affect asphalt maintenance for local businesses?
Properties near the San Leandro Marina and the bay shoreline experience salt-laden air and higher humidity, which can accelerate asphalt oxidation and cracking. Regular sealcoating every 2-3 years is strongly recommended for commercial lots in those areas to protect against premature wear from the coastal environment.
